Partilhar via


Interface IMetadataStoreUpgradeCallback

Quando implementado por uma classe derivada, representa métodos que o Sync Framework pode chamar para notificar um provedor de que o formato de arquivo do repositório de metadados está prestes a ser atualizado.

interface IMetadataStoreUpgradeCallback : IUnknown

Membros

Método IMetadataStoreUpgradeCallback Descrição

IMetadataStoreUpgradeCallback::OnMetadataStoreFileUpgradeStart

Chamado pelo Sync Framework antes da atualização do formato de arquivo de repositório de metadados. Retorna um valor que indica se a atualização pode ser executada.

IMetadataStoreUpgradeCallback::OnMetadataStoreFileUpgradeComplete

Chamado pelo Sync Framework depois que a atualização do formato do arquivo de repositório de metadados é concluída.

Comentários

Normalmente, IMetadataStoreUpgradeCallback é implementado por um provedor.

Quando um arquivo de repositório de metadados no formato 1.0 é aberto pelo Sync Framework 2.0, ele é atualizado automaticamente para o formato 2.0, a menos que o provedor se registre para ser notificado da atualização e indique que o serviço de armazenamento de metadados não deve atualizar o formato do arquivo. Para se registrar para receber notificações de atualização, passe um objeto IMetadataStoreUpgradeCallback para ISyncMetadataStore2::SetMetadataStoreUpgradeNotificationCallback antes de abrir o repositório de metadados.

Requisitos

Cabeçalho: MetaStore.h

Consulte também

Conceitos

Componentes do Sync Framework Metadata Storage Service